Job Summary
To plan and deliver Human Resources plans and solutions in line with the needs and priorities of the hospital. The incumbent is required to perform full generalist functions including recruitment and selection, employee relations, training and supervision of hospital related administrative processes.
Minimum Qualifications and Experience- 3 years Diploma in Human Resources Management or Equivalent NQF7 qualification
- 3-5 years human resources generalist experience
- Working knowledge of Talent Acquisition, Performance Management, Learning and Development (training), Industrial Relations and Talent management
- Knowledge of relevant Labour Relations
- Knowledge of the Basic Conditions of Employment Act
Job Requirements
- Provide expert HR advice and guidance to managers and staff on HR matters, supporting managers in dealing with complex issues, performance, attendance and employee relations issues.
- Identify HR priorities from Head Office and Hospital plans, translating business requirements into effective HR practices (relevant to the facility) and delivering people solutions aligned to business objectives.
- Deliver people solutions across the HR spectrum, including workforce planning, onboarding, recruitment and selection, employee relations, employee engagement and performance management.
- Analyse and report HR information to support benchmarking and the development of hospital-based HR strategies and solutions.
- Provide up-to-date knowledge of the legal frameworks within hospitals and ensure implemented HR policies are in line with current legislation.
- Adhere to all personnel administration policies, processes, system/technologies and procedures; ensuring that all personnel records/data are accurate and up to date.
- Coordinate grievances, ensuring that grievance procedures are correctly followed and that all matters of grievance are lodged and managed appropriately by management.
- Collaborate and support Line Managers during the performance management cycle (i.e. clarifying goals, expectations, providing feedback and evaluating results) in identifying and correcting poor performance.
- Provide project management expertise through the initiation, management and driving of projects and HR initiatives at hospital level.
